在开发react后,打包生成了dist包,发布到线上后,因为html中css和js文件的hash值已经改变了,但浏览器依然是使用的缓存的html文件,导致资源文件请求失败报错。
想问一下有什么办法可以解决这个问题吗?
在开发react后,打包生成了dist包,发布到线上后,因为html中css和js文件的hash值已经改变了,但浏览器依然是使用的缓存的html文件,导致资源文件请求失败报错。
想问一下有什么办法可以解决这个问题吗?
4 回答1.7k 阅读
2 回答1.1k 阅读✓ 已解决
2 回答2.6k 阅读
1 回答973 阅读✓ 已解决
2 回答899 阅读✓ 已解决
1 回答698 阅读✓ 已解决
2 回答862 阅读✓ 已解决
我们公司的项目通常在网站加载index.html时在url query加上版本号,每次更新代码后同时更新版本号。